What to Look for in Skincare Products
Before jumping into what specific products to buy, it’s essential to understand what to look for when selecting skincare products. Common ingredients that are beneficial include:
- Hyaluronic Acid: Great for hydration.
- Retinol: Helps reduce the appearance of fine lines.
- Salicylic Acid: Excellent for acne-prone skin.
- Niacinamide: Known for its brightening effects.
- SPF: Essential for daily sun protection.
Each ingredient serves specific purposes, so understanding your skin’s needs will lead to better choices.

CeraVe Hydrating Cleanser
The CeraVe Hydrating Cleanser is a staple in many skincare routines and often found at Costco. This gentle cleanser contains ceramides and hyaluronic acid, which help to maintain the skin’s natural barrier while providing hydration. The non-foaming formula is suitable for normal to dry skin types, making it a great choice for sensitive skin as well.
Neutrogena Hydro Boost Water Gel
This moisturizer is a favorite among dermatologists for its lightweight texture and powerful hydrating ingredients, primarily hyaluronic acid. Neutrogena’s Hydro Boost Water Gel absorbs quickly, providing ample moisture without a greasy residue. Perfect for everyday use, it’s ideal for those looking for a refreshing boost, particularly during the dryer months.
Aveeno Positively Radiant Daily Moisturizer with SPF
Aveeno’s commitment to using natural ingredients shines through in its Positively Radiant line. This daily moisturizer includes soy complex and offers broad-spectrum SPF 30 protection, making it a fantastic two-in-one product. The lightweight formula helps even skin tone while providing essential sun protection, which is a non-negotiable in skincare routines.

Skinfix Barrier+ Foaming Oil Cleanser
This innovative foaming oil cleanser gently removes dirt and makeup while maintaining the skin’s moisture barrier. Enriched with natural oils, this option is great for all skin types, especially those with sensitive skin or conditions like eczema. The Importance of Sunscreen
One of the most important aspects of skincare is daily sun protection. Costco often has various sunscreens that offer broad spectrum coverage. Look for mineral or chemical options, depending on your skin’s sensitivity.
Coppertone Sport Sunscreen Lotion
For those who lead active lifestyles, Coppertone Sport offers effective protection that stands up against sweat and water. It’s lightweight, absorbs quickly, and is sweat-resistant, making it an ideal choice for beach days or outdoor activities.
La Roche-Posay Anthelios Melt-in Milk Sunscreen
This sunscreen is highly regarded for its effective ingredients and love for sensitive skin. It provides a broad spectrum SPF 60 protection without leaving a white cast. The lightweight texture melts into the skin, making it a favorite for daily wear, even under makeup.

Building a Skincare Routine
With so many fantastic options available at Costco, creating an effective skincare routine becomes manageable. Consider the following steps when crafting your routine based on dermatologist advice:
Step 1: Cleanser
Start with a gentle cleanser suited to your skin type. Look for something hydrating or exfoliating, depending on your needs.
Step 2: Serum
Incorporate a serum that addresses specific concerns such as hydration, brightening, or anti-aging. Look for serums containing vitamin C or peptides.
Step 3: Moisturizer
Follow your serum application with a suitable moisturizer. A lightweight option is perfect for day use, while a richer cream can benefit nighttime routines.
Step 4: Sunscreen
Even on cloudy days, incorporating sunscreen into your daily regimen is non-negotiable. Choose a broad-spectrum option with at least SPF 30.
Step 5: Special Treatments
At night, consider adding specialized treatments like retinol or sleeping masks to boost skin renewal. These treatments help enhance your overall skincare results.
